Planning Your Move: Checklist and Timeline

Packed boxes and protective furniture covers for a Herongate move

Effective planning is at the heart of successful Removals in Herongate. Start with a 6-8 week checklist: declutter, inventory, book your removal date, arrange utilities and confirm access at both properties.

Two weeks before moving, confirm parking and lift access, label boxes clearly, and set aside essentials for the first night. Use a room-by-room inventory to help with insurance and tracking.

On moving day, assign someone to supervise and keep important documents and valuables with you. Professional local movers typically offer last-minute support, but early booking secures the best teams.

How to Prepare Your Home for a Smooth Move

Moving checklist and packing materials for removals in Herongate

Preparation reduces time and damage on moving day. Protect floors with coverings, remove breakable ornaments from shelves, and empty wardrobes to speed up loading.

Label boxes clearly with room names and content notes, and consider a colour-coded system to match items to rooms in your new property.

Communication with your removal team is essential: clarify arrival time, parking arrangements, and any access limitations to avoid delays.

Packing Tips from Moving Experts

Packing smart saves time and reduces stress. Start with non-essentials and use quality boxes to avoid collapse. Wrap fragile items individually and use towels or clothing as padding for extra protection.

Labeling with both room and content makes unpacking faster. Keep an essentials box for toiletries, chargers and key kitchen items so you can function on day one in your new home.

Pro movers often provide custom crating for large or fragile pieces and can supply wardrobe boxes to keep clothes on hangers throughout the move.

Insurance, Liability and Peace of Mind

Insurance is a crucial part of any professional removal. Check whether your chosen company offers transit insurance and what it covers. Basic cover may be included, but high-value items often require declared-value cover.

Inventory records help claim any damages. Reputable removal services in Herongate will perform a pre-move assessment and provide documentation to protect both parties.

Ask about dispute resolution processes and written terms so you know how issues are handled after the move.

Additional Tips for Moving in the Area

Book well ahead for peak moving months (spring and summer) and consider weekday moves to avoid weekend parking congestion. If you have a garden feature being moved, measure access points carefully in advance.

Notify neighbours when large vehicles will be present — this courtesy often avoids complaints and facilitates smoother parking arrangements.

Keep an up-to-date inventory and photograph valuable items before the move to streamline any insurance claims or disputes.

Final Checklist Before Moving Day

Confirm timings with your removal company, clear access routes, and have essentials packed and labelled. Check that pets and children have safe arrangements for moving day.

Prepare a folder with all move-related paperwork, including your quote, insurance documents and inventory list, and keep it with you throughout the move.

On arrival, inspect delivered items with the removal team and note any concerns immediately against the inventory report.
